We tell the story of IDF officer Elkana Bar Eitan, who was seriously wounded in 2006. Living with constant, severe pain, he declined surgery and other treatment and carried on as if nothing was wrong. In 2023, he was called up again and returned to combat—afraid that if a medical committee knew the truth, they would stop him. Thousands of Israelis, and millions of people around the world, say the same words every day: “I’m fine, really.” Often, they’re not. And they have many reasons for not telling the truth. If nothing else, this should make us more understanding—and more patient—when we hear those words.
